The postcode L20 9AY is located in Sefton, in the county of Merseyside.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. L20 9AY is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

L20 9AY is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 1 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of L20 9AY as Hard-pressed living > Challenged terraced workers > Deprived blue-collar terraces.

The closest road name to L20 9AY is Sussex Street which is centered 62 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Earl Road and is 15 m away. The closest railway station is Bootle New Strand Rail Station, 721 m away.

The closest primary school to L20 9AY (for ages 11 and under) is Christ Church Church of England Controlled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on May 23, 2018.

The local pub for residents of L20 9AY is Crossways Bar and is 3.28 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Good on July 25, 2019. The nearest takeaway food is available from Ballynure Village Chippy and is 3.25 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on June 28, 2021.

Residents reported an average download speed of 252.1 Mbps and an average upload speed of 19.1 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 80%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 80%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ps. 10% of residents have broadband access of 10-30 Mbps. 10% of residents have broadband access of 5-10 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.4 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.3 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for L20 9AY is covered by the Merseyside police force association and Sefton is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
